Smart airports leverage advanced technologies such as the Internet of Things (IoT), artificial intelligence (AI), big data analytics, and biometric systems to enhance airport operations, improve passenger experience, and optimize resource management. These airports use real-time data and automation to streamline various aspects of air travel — from check-in and security to baggage handling and boarding. For example, facial recognition technology enables faster passenger identification, while predictive maintenance systems ensure operational efficiency by minimizing equipment downtime.

Additionally, smart airports are committed to improving sustainability and energy efficiency. Through smart lighting, HVAC systems, and waste management, these airports aim to reduce their environmental footprint. They also enhance security through integrated surveillance and analytics, and improve communication between different airport departments and stakeholders. By providing passengers with mobile apps, real-time flight updates, and seamless connectivity, smart airports not only reduce wait times but also deliver a more personalized and stress-free travel experience.
